Instructions
In a spacious mixing bowl, begin by combining the sifted powdered sugar and the egg whites. Ensure both ingredients are well integrated before proceeding.
Using an electric mixer, start beating the mixture on a low speed for about 1 minute. This initial step will help blend the ingredients together.
Gradually increase the mixer speed to medium and continue beating for an additional 4-5 minutes. You'll know the icing is ready when it reaches stiff peaks, holding its shape firmly.
Once the stiff peaks have formed, introduce the fresh lemon juice and vanilla extract (if desired). Continue mixing on low speed for another minute to ensure these flavors are thoroughly incorporated.
If you’d like to add color to your icing, divide the mixture among several small bowls. Add a drop or two of your chosen food coloring to each bowl, then stir gently until the icing reaches your desired hue.
To prevent the royal icing from drying out while you’re working, cover the bowl with a damp cloth or plastic wrap until you are ready to use it.
